W-SCRS

A dedicated activated carbon regeneration system that regenerates activated carbon used in filtration facilities through a low-temperature pyrolysis process using oxygen-free superheated steam, improving adsorption performance.

Process

  • STEP 1

    Spent carbon carry-in

    In advanced drinking-water treatment facilities, granular activated carbon with reduced adsorption performance is excavated and transported to a superheated-steam regeneration facility.

  • STEP 2

    Spent carbon
    feeding process

    Spent carbon with reduced adsorption performance is fed into the superheated-steam regeneration facility through screening equipment, transfer conveyors, and an ejector.

  • STEP 3

    Regeneration process
    (superheated steam)

    Generates superheated steam above 600°C using a superheated steam boiler and sprays it through the injection tube inside the regeneration unit (restoring adsorption capacity).

  • STEP 4

    Regenerated
    carbon discharge
    and carry-out

    Regenerated activated carbon that has regained adsorption capacity through superheated-steam regeneration is loaded into the activated carbon adsorption basin at the advanced drinking-water treatment facility for reuse.
